Undergraduates studying part-time at Herzing University-Birmingham generally pay $515 per credit.
| Cost Per Credit Hour | |
|---|---|
| Part-Time Undergraduate | $515 |
Note that the per-credit-hour cost shown here is the published rate, not counting any grant aid or scholarships that could lower the cost.
For reference, here is the full-year tuition and fee breakdown for full-time undergraduates at Herzing University-Birmingham are listed below.
Required fees account for came to $1,090; the balance is base tuition.
| Most Recent Reported Year | |
|---|---|
| Tuition | $12,360 |
| Fees | $1,090 |
| Total | $13,450 |
This annual figure is for academic instruction only and excludes room and board costs.
This is how tuition at Herzing University-Birmingham has tracked across the last few reported years.
| Year | Tuition |
|---|---|
| Three Years Ago | $13,320 |
| Two Years Ago | $11,820 |
| One Year Ago | $12,360 |
| Most Recent Year | $12,360 |
